I have just bought a Tikka T3 TACTICAL in .223. The barrel is 24'' and has a twist rate of 1 in 8 .
I am looking for a good TARGET load. I have 69gr Sierras at present however if anyone knows a very accurate load let me know.......I am open to all suggestions.
I wish to shoot on the range from 200yds. Sometimes even 400yds.

The only way to know if a load is accurate in your rifle is to take the bullets, a couple different powders, and start experimenting within the limits of the reloading manuals. It is impossible to say if one load that is accurate in gun A will even be close to accurate in guns B or C. I would find 3 powders that give the velocities you want, load some up and then pick the most accurate powder, then work slightly with the load to get to where you want to be accuracy wise.
